Sugar Free Cranberry Sauce

Recipe By Lakanto


The classic, Thanksgiving staple, now without any added sugar! With the perfect touch of citrus and spice for flavoring, this will be a family favorite for years to come.

INGREDIENTS

1 12-ounce bag cranberries 1 cup Classic Monkfruit Sweetener (also available in Organic) 2 tablespoons orange zest 1 cup water 1 stick cinnamon 1 small pinch ground cloves

INSTRUCTIONS

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ees.

  • Wash cranberries and place in 9×13 baking dish. Add water, cloves, cinnamon stick, and orange zest and sprinkle with Classic Monkfruit Sweetener.

  • Bake 1 hour.

  • Remove from oven, remove the cinnamon stick, and allow it to cool.

  • If you like it with a little texture, mash berries; if you prefer it smooth, process it in blender or food processor until desired consistency is reached.

  • Serve with turkey, turkey sandwiches, or on top of ice cream or cobbler or eat it by the spoonful.

This can be made and refrigerated up to a week in advance or frozen for up to three months.
